Functional Description
Laminin alpha-5 receptor. May mediate intracellular signaling.
Sequence Annotation
Topological domain: 32 547 Extracellular.
Transmembrane: 548 568 Helical.
Topological domain: 569 628 Cytoplasmic.
Domain: 32 142 Ig-like V-type 1.
Domain: 147 257 Ig-like V-type 2.
Domain: 274 355 Ig-like C2-type 1.
Domain: 363 441 Ig-like C2-type 2.
Domain: 448 541 Ig-like C2-type 3.
Region: 309 312 Interaction with laminin alpha5.
Modified residue: 596 596 Phosphoserine; by GSK3.
Modified residue: 598 598 Phosphoserine; by CK2.
Modified residue: 621 621 Phosphoserine; by PKA.
